Dodson Creek Solar is a photovoltaic solar energy project located in Hillsboro, with a capacity of 117 megawatts. The project is operated by Dodson Creek Solar and is owned by the Washington State Investment Board. It is situated within the PJM Interconnection power control area and is classified as an unregulated facility. The project is expected to come online in 2025, harnessing solar energy as its primary fuel source.
